Bake Happy (Bake Believe Series Book 3) by Cori Cooper – Review by Nakyshia Leger

Bake HappyBake Happy by Cori Cooper
My rating: 5 of 5 stars

Cat and Robyn are at it again! When a surprise brings Cat and her enemy Nate together, their worlds are turned upside down. There is no choice but for them to work together and try to fix the situation. Can they find a way to stand one another long enough to fix the biggest problem Cat has faced?

This was such a fun and feel good read! I am SO sad that this is the last of Cat’s story. I have fallen in love from day one, in Bake Believe. Cat is fun loving and adventurous. Like the other books in this trilogy, I love the point of view the author has created. Readers are inside of Cat’s mind while she is going on rambling tangents with her as she figures out her world. Cat’s brain works a lot like mine and I love that. Of course she could do nothing without her cousin and best friend Robyn, who compliments her perfectly while still being her partner in crime. One of my favorite parts is of course the recipes! Each chapter has a delicious recipe at the end that compliments the story. My daughters and I actually baked our way through this book and the recipes are DELICIOUS. It was such a fun way for us to connect as we read this story together.
